The leather industry is witnessing a transformative shift in B2B exports, driven by changing consumer demands and technological advancements. As a manufacturer or supplier, understanding these dynamics is critical for future success.
Global trade for leather products, including jackets, bags, and accessories, has seen a significant increase over the last decade. With countries like Italy, India, and Brazil leading the charge, the competition is fierce. Businesses need to innovate and adapt to stay ahead.
Several trends are shaping the market today: sustainability, customization, and direct-to-consumer models. Suppliers must embrace these changes to meet the evolving demands of wholesale buyers.
To thrive in the competitive export market, manufacturers should focus on these key areas:
Quality assurance is paramount. Investing in high-grade materials will not only satisfy regulations but also attract premium buyers.
From virtual showrooms to AI-driven inventory management, technology can streamline operations and enhance customer experiences.
Networking with buyers and other suppliers can open doors to partnerships and collaborations that enhance market reach.
As the B2B leather export market evolves, it’s essential to stay informed and agile. By implementing innovative strategies, businesses can secure their place in the global market.
